We had a wonderful relaxing day at HK Disney. It is much like Magic Kingdom, just a little smaller. They did have the Buzz Lightyear ride, which is the boys favorite. They also had It's a Small World, Space Mountain, the Dumbo ride, and several other popular rides. It was neat to see how things were different, like an asian Cinderella with a blonde wig and an Asian twist to the Jungle Cruise. One of our favorites is the Muppet's 3-D show, and HK Disney had their own version called Mickey's PhilHarMagic Show. We took the HK subway (MTR) into the city to meet our guide for the tour. It was very clean and modern.
















This is a sampan in the HK harbour. We took a ride on one of these and got to see the many fishing boats where some fishermen and their families live. Our tour guide Alan told us that these house boats will be a thing of the past in the next year or so because the government is taking over and filling in the harbour so that they can build more high rises.
